Culinary Offerings in Camden Market
All kinds of eateries can be found at Camden Market, from cafés to patio bars, fresh food booths to bakers. You can choose to eat at one of the huge communal tables or down by the canal. An excellent starting point for foodies is Camden Lock Market’s West Yard, which has everything from French and Argentine to Japanese and Caribbean.
Hours of Operation and How to Reach the Location

There is some leeway for individual merchants to choose their own opening and closing times, but in general, the market is open each day at 10 a.m and closes at 6 p.m. The weekend is often when the market is most congested; if you don’t feel like having to squeeze through the crowds, your best bet is to go on Thursday or Friday. Chalk Farm and Camden Town are the two tube stations that are located most conveniently nearby.
